Description of problem:
Cisco UCS blades panic very frequently

Version-Release number of selected component (if applicable):
Linux dblab1.tor.afilias-int.info 2.6.18-238.9.1.el5 #1 SMP Fri Mar 18 12:42:39 EDT 2011 x86_64 x86_64 x86_64 GNU/Linux

How reproducible:
Power on a UCS blade with RHEL 5.6

Steps to Reproduce:
1. Power on a UCS blade with RHEL 5.6
2. Wait a while (few minutes)
3. Enjoy panic
  
Actual results:
Kernel Panic

Expected results:
Machine that works

Additional info:

Cisco UCS is at firmware Version 1.4(1j).  The Paolo Mezzanine card is installed.
Screenshot of the panic is included.    I can find no reason for why this happenes.  I have 4 blades in 2 chassises and all of them are behaving like this.  I even tried things like logging on the console and doing a service network stop and that does not prevent the panic.
Each blade has 2 SAN HBA's and 4 Nicks defined.  RHEL 5.6 is deployed using a PXE booted kickstart we use for all of our servers and vm's without any problems.
